India vs West Indies Women World Cup Highlights: India beat West Indies by 6 wickets

IND W vs WI W Live: India beat West Indies by six wickets to notch up their second consecutive win in the Women's T20 World Cup on Wednesday. India chased down the target of 119 with 11 balls to spare with wicketkeeper-batter Richa Ghosh top-scoring with 44 not out off 32 balls. Captain Harmanpreet Kaur and opener Shafali Verma contributed 33 and 28 respectively as India reached 119 for 4 in 18.1 overs. Earlier, electing to bat, West Indies posted 118 for 6 in the Group 2 match.

India produced an all-round performance to register a comfortable six-wicket victory over West Indies in their Group 2 match on Wednesday in Cape Town, their second consecutive win at the ICC Women's T20 World Cup. India defeated arch-rivals Pakistan in their campaign opener. Richa hit the winning runs, a four off Shamilia Connell in the penultimate over, as India chased down the below-par 119-run target in 18.1 overs with six wickets in hand.

West Indies Women will be ruing the opportunity they had early in the game as they started well despite losing skipper Hayley Matthews early. Shemaine Campbelle and Stafanie Taylor added 73 runs together but they lost a few wickets in quick succession which pegged them back quite drastically. Chedean Nation and Shabika Gajnabi looked to push the scoring but were unable to help their side cross the 120-run mark. Deepti Sharma was the pick of the bowlers for India Women taking three scalps and getting to 100 T20I wickets thereby becoming the first Indian to achieve this feat. Renuka Singh and Pooja Vastrakar were also impressive with the ball and together they made the job quite easy for their batters.

India Women started the run chase strong with Shafali Verma and Smriti Mandhana scoring 28 runs in the first two overs from the pacers but they found it difficult once the spinners came into play. Smriti Mandhana was dismissed playing a rash shot and Jemimah Rodrigues could not carry her form from the last game into this match. When Shafali Verma holed out in the deep it looked like West Indies Women may find a way back into this game. Harmanpreet Kaur got together with Richa Ghosh and added 72 runs for the fourth wicket to take their team close to the finish line. Harmanpreet Kaur did give her wicket away but Richa Ghosh is showing how much she has matured as a cricketer.

Richa Ghosh is India Women's designated finisher! Another comfortable win for India Women as they seal their second win of the campaign winning this game by 6 wickets with 11 balls to spare. West Indies Women did start the game off well but could not sustain their performance and have now lost 15 consecutive T20I games in a row. This is their eighth loss in a row against this opposition and their World Cup dreams now lie in the balance with their second defeat in as many games. Karishma Ramharack was a revelation though as she claimed two wickets for 14 runs in her four overs. Hayley Matthews was also good with the ball but the pace bowlers were taken for plenty. They do have massive issues with Stafanie Taylor and Hayley Matthews both leaving the field with injuries.
